Chapter 4 - Vector Spaces - 4.1 Vectors in Rn - 4.1 Exercises - Page 153: 45

Answer

$$v= u_1+2u_2-3u_3.$$

Work Step by Step

Suppose the linear combination $v= au_1+bu_2+cu_3$, then we have $$(10,1,4)=a(2,3,5)+b(-1,2,4)+c(-2,2,3), \quad a,b,c\in R.$$ Which yields the following system of equations \begin{align*} 2a-b-2c&=10\\ 3a+2b+2c&=1\\ 4a+4b+3c&=4. \end{align*} Solving the above system, we get the solution $a=1$, $b=2$, $c=-3$. Hence, $$v= u_1+2u_2-3u_3.$$
